When Does House Leveling Make Sense?

Deciding to level your house can be a tough call. It's a major investment, and you want to make sure it's the right decision. Before you jump into this project, there are several important factors to consider. First and foremost, examine the extent of your foundation concerns. A minor settling might be manageable with other solutions, while a more serious issue likely professional attention.

Next, think about the age of your house. Older homes are at risk for foundation problems due to aging. The type of soil beneath your house also plays a role. Clay soil, for instance, can expand and contract with changes in humidity, causing shifting and cracks.

Finally, consider the cost of leveling versus other solutions. Get bids from reputable contractors to evaluate pricing. Factor in the inconvenience of construction and probable financial impacts for renovations that might be necessary as a result. By carefully considering these factors, you can make an informed decision about whether house leveling is the right move for your situation.

Signs Your House Needs Leveling & How To Fix It

A sagging foundation can be a serious problem for homeowners. While it might seem like just an aesthetic issue at first, unevenness suggests structural problems that could lead to costly damage down the road. Here are some common signs your house needs leveling:

* Doors and windows that stick or close improperly.

* Uneven floors that appear sloping.

* Cracks in walls, ceilings, or foundations that are new or growing.

* Gaps appearing between walls and ceilings.

Addressing foundation issues requires a professional touch. Experienced contractors can use techniques like piering and underpinning to stabilize the structure read more and bring your house back to level. It's crucial to act quickly if you notice any of these signs, as early intervention can prevent further damage and save you time.

Understanding House Foundation Issues and Repair Options

A stable house foundation is crucial for the overall integrity of your home. Over time, foundations can develop various problems, ranging from minor shifts to more critical structural problems. Recognizing the indicators of foundation issues early on is vital for timely repairs and preventing further damage.

Common factors of foundation problems include earth movement, water ingress, improper water flow, and the shifting of building materials. Depending the severity and nature of the issue, there are a range of repair solutions available.

  • Foundation: This includes supporting the foundation by adding piers beneath the existing structure.
  • Joint: Repairing cracks in the foundation with specialized materials can help prevent further water penetration.
  • Drainage: Correcting drainage issues around your home by modifying the slope of the land can reduce water buildup and foundation damage.

It's crucial to consult a qualified engineering professional to properly diagnose the issue and recommend the most appropriate repair strategy.
